云平台CPU分配率:揭秘背后的计算与优化策略
结论:云平台的CPU分配率并非一个固定的数值,它取决于多个因素,包括用户需求、服务商策略、资源利用率和平台技术架构等。一般来说,云服务提供商为了保证服务质量,会将CPU分配率设定在一个合理的范围内,以确保用户的性能需求得到满足,同时避免资源浪费。然而,这个“合理范围”通常在50%-100%之间浮动,具体数值需要根据实际情况进行调整。
正文:
在数字化时代,云平台已成为企业和个人的重要基础设施,而CPU作为云服务器的核心组件,其分配率直接影响到应用的运行效率和用户体验。然而,云平台的CPU分配率并不是一个简单的问题,它涉及到复杂的计算和优化策略。
首先,CPU分配率受到用户需求的影响。不同的业务场景对CPU的需求差异巨大,例如,高并发的Web应用可能需要更高的CPU利用率,而数据处理或机器学习任务可能更依赖于稳定的计算能力。因此,云服务商通常会提供不同配置的实例类型,以适应这些不同的需求,对应的CPU分配率也会有所不同。
其次,服务商的资源管理策略也会影响CPU分配率。为了提高硬件资源的使用效率,云服务商可能会采用超分技术,即将一个物理CPU核心虚拟化为多个逻辑核心,分配给多个用户。在这种情况下,每个用户的CPU分配率可能会低于100%,以防止过度竞争导致性能下降。
再者,云平台的技术架构也是决定CPU分配率的关键。一些云服务商采用了动态调整策略,可以根据实时的工作负载自动调整CPU分配,保证在高峰期提供足够的计算力,而在低谷期则可以节省能源,这种灵活的分配方式使得CPU分配率无法用一个固定的数字来描述。
最后,云平台的CPU分配率还受到硬件和软件优化的影响。比如,采用最新的处理器技术、优化的操作系统内核以及高效的虚拟化技术,都可以提升CPU的使用效率,从而在保持或提高分配率的同时,提高整体性能。
总的来说,云平台的CPU分配率是一个动态变化、因需而异的概念。理解并掌握这一概念,对于选择合适的云服务、优化应用性能以及有效利用云资源具有重要意义。在实际应用中,用户应根据自身需求,结合服务商的策略和技术特点,选择最适合自己的CPU分配方案,以实现最佳的计算效率和成本效益。
云计算